There's been a discussion over on the Big Kahuna thread on just this issue. The consensus is that there is no Head and Shoulders on DELL - the volume is wrong and there is a first peak in July before the left shoulder.

However, there could be a broadening top which is also bearish. If DELL reaches a new high in the current rally that prognosis is also off.

Really it is extremely difficult to see DELL go down unless the general market does too. I can't see the latter happening anytime soon.

So Dellicious is possibly right and the sell-off will come after earnings.
